Cost of Living in Bad Sรคckingen - Updated Prices & Insights

Monthly Cost of Living

Living costs for one person come to about $1,922 monthly including rent, or $847 excluding housing.

Estimated monthly costs for a couple: $2,944 with rent, or $1,777 without housing.

Monthly costs for a family of three come to about $3,966 including rent, or $2,708 for daily expenses alone.

Bad Sรคckingen sits 40โ€“43% above the global median across household types. Within Europe, costs are slightly above average (8%) โ€“ still relatively affordable for the region.

Cost Breakdown

Expect to pay about $830 for a central one-bedroom, or $701 outside the center. At 28% of the average salary ($2,942), housing is the biggest financial pressure.

Average take-home pay sits at $2,942, while typical expenses reach $1,922. This leaves solid room for saving and lifestyle spending.

Expect to spend about $313 monthly on groceries. Dining out at a mid-range restaurant costs roughly $81.0 for two โ€“ broadly in line with the European average.

Public transport is priced at around $63.0 per month โ€“ above the European average of $48.00.

Cost Highlights

Bad Sรคckingen is more expensive than 63% of cities worldwide and 64% within Europe.

How much of a salary does housing take in Bad Sรคckingen?
With 28% of the average paycheck going to rent, Bad Sรคckingen is on the expensive side for housing. Many locals cope by sharing apartments, moving to outer neighborhoods, or downsizing to keep things manageable.
How much does it cost to live in Bad Sรคckingen per month?
Plan for roughly $1,922 a month in Bad Sรคckingen if you're renting, or around $847 for non-housing expenses. That covers one person's basics: food, bills, getting around, and a modest social life. Couples and families will need more, especially for housing and childcare.
How much should you earn to live well in Bad Sรคckingen?
Earning $2,883 monthly in Bad Sรคckingen means you're living well โ€“ a one-bedroom, regular groceries, transport, and some entertainment without stress. That's the threshold where most residents feel genuinely comfortable rather than just getting by.
What is the price of renting a flat in Bad Sรคckingen?
Rents for a 1-bedroom flat in Bad Sรคckingen range from $701 to $830, depending on location and condition. Central apartments sit at the top of that range; outer neighborhoods and suburbs deliver noticeably better value per square meter.
What does commuting cost in Bad Sรคckingen?
A monthly transit pass in Bad Sรคckingen goes for roughly $63.0, which is one of the lighter items on a monthly budget. Coverage across residential and business areas is solid, and most residents without a car rely on it daily.
What are kindergarten prices in Bad Sรคckingen?
Childcare averages $644 monthly at a private kindergarten in Bad Sรคckingen. For many families, this single cost rivals rent, so it's essential to factor in before making a move.
